A massive fight took place over the weekend. After facing one another back in January, Liam Smith squared off against Chris Eubank Jr. for their rematch. In their first clash, Smith got a stoppage victory in the fourth round after dominating, ‘The Next Gen,’ for the entire fight. However, their rematch was quite the contrary to their first fight. Not only was the outcome different but the fight in itself. After dominating, ‘Beefy,’ for nine rounds, the 33-year-old secured a stoppage victory in the tenth and avenged his previous defeat.

Moreover, the bout attracted controversy after Smith claimed that he had an injury during training camp. According to him, the injury jeopardized his preparations and subsequently, the boxer had to lose weight.  The 35-year-old had to go through a stringent weight cut. It is reported that he had to cut down 42 lbs to make weight and such a drastic weight cut affected his performance. However, the fans did not buy this claim and tagged it as an “excuse,” for his devastating defeat.
